Biomass Pyrolysis: Choosing the Right Biomass Feedstock

Biomass Pyrolysis: Choosing the Right Biomass Feedstock

Biomass pyrolysis is an increasingly popular method used to convert biomass into valuable products, such as biofuels and biochar. This thermochemical process involves heating biomass in the absence of oxygen to produce useful byproducts. However, the success of biomass pyrolysis greatly depends on the selection of the biomass feedstock.

Choosing the right biomass feedstock is crucial to achieve high-quality output and maximize the overall efficiency of the pyrolysis process. Various factors need to be considered when selecting a biomass feedstock, including its composition, availability, and suitability for pyrolysis.

1. Composition: The chemical composition of the biomass feedstock plays a significant role in determining the type and amount of end products obtained during pyrolysis. Different feedstocks contain varying amounts of cellulose, hemicellulose, and lignin, which have distinct pyrolysis behaviors. Ideally, a feedstock with a balance of these components is desirable, as it can result in a diverse range of valuable products.

2. Moisture Content: The moisture content of the biomass feedstock directly affects the pyrolysis process. High moisture content can disrupt the heating process and increase energy consumption, leading to lower product yields. Therefore, it is preferable to choose feedstocks with low moisture content to minimize these issues.

3. Availability: The availability and accessibility of the biomass feedstock are important considerations. Ideally, feedstocks that are locally available and abundant should be prioritized to reduce transportation costs and environmental impact associated with long-distance transportation. Additionally, the availability of feedstocks throughout the year should also be considered to ensure a continuous supply for the pyrolysis process.

4. Sustainability: Sustainable feedstock selection is essential to ensure the long-term viability and environmental friendliness of biomass pyrolysis. It is important to choose feedstocks that are produced in a sustainable manner, minimizing their impact on land use, water resources, and biodiversity. Additionally, using waste biomass or agricultural residues as feedstock can be a viable option to effectively utilize biomass resources and reduce environmental burdens.

5. Pre-treatment Requirements: Some biomass feedstocks might require pre-treatment before undergoing pyrolysis to improve their suitability for the process. Pre-treatment methods like drying, grinding, and size reduction can enhance the efficiency of the pyrolysis process and produce higher-quality end products. Understanding the pre-treatment requirements of various feedstocks is crucial for optimizing the pyrolysis process.

In conclusion, selecting the right biomass feedstock plays a crucial role in the success of biomass pyrolysis. Considering factors such as composition, moisture content, availability, sustainability, and pre-treatment requirements is essential in maximizing the efficiency and product yields of the pyrolysis process. By making informed choices, we can unlock the full potential of biomass pyrolysis and contribute to the sustainable production of valuable bio-based products.
